everclear1984 Posted November 30, 2015 Share Posted November 30, 2015 You're right to wait, you'll get a fraction of what it's worth this time of year. I've sold several bikes through eBay, just factor in what you'll lose in fees. You could always list it as a private sale, that way you only pay a listing fee, no final sale or paypal fees to worry about.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
